Fault Codes:Hitachi ZX240-5A P0641(1079-2)
What is Hitachi ZX240-5A Fault Code P0641(1079-2)?
Fault Code P0641(1079-2) indicates a problem with the Sensor Reference Voltage "A" Circuit in the Engine Control Module (ECM). This code specifically means the ECM has detected an open or short circuit in the 5-volt reference voltage supply that powers multiple critical sensors throughout the machine's engine management system.
The 5-volt reference circuit acts as a power backbone for throttle position sensors, manifold absolute pressure (MAP) sensors, and other vital input devices that allow the ECM to calculate proper fuel delivery, boost pressure, and emissions control. On the Hitachi ZX240-5A, this Isuzu-powered excavator relies heavily on precise sensor data to maintain optimal performance and meet Tier 3 emissions standards. When this reference voltage fails, the engine cannot accurately monitor operating conditions, leading to significant performance degradation or complete shutdown protection modes.
Common Symptoms
- Check Engine Light illuminated on the instrument panel with reduced engine power
- Engine enters derate mode or limp mode, limiting RPM to 1200-1500 range
- Erratic engine behavior including rough idle, hesitation during throttle application, or unexpected stalling
- Multiple fault codes appearing simultaneously due to sensor communication failures
- Black smoke from exhaust due to improper fuel mapping from failed sensor inputs
Potential Causes
The most common causes for P0641(1079-2) on used ZX240-5A excavators include:
- Damaged wiring harness near the engine valley where heat and vibration cause insulation breakdown
- Corroded connectors at the ECM or individual sensors, especially in machines exposed to dusty or wet conditions
- Shorted sensor (particularly throttle position sensor or MAP sensor) pulling down the entire reference circuit
- Failed ECM internal voltage regulator—less common but possible in high-hour machines (over 8,000 hours)
- Chafed wires at known rub points near the fuel injection pump or along the rocker cover edge
- Aftermarket sensor installations with incorrect resistance values causing circuit overload
How to Troubleshoot and Fix Code P0641(1079-2)
Step 1: Visual Inspection of Wiring Harness Begin by thoroughly inspecting the engine harness, particularly around heat sources and moving components. On used excavators, check for wire insulation cracks, oil saturation, or harness ties that have broken allowing wires to contact sharp edges. Pay special attention to the valley between cylinder banks where heat degradation is common.
Step 2: Test Reference Voltage at ECM Connector Using a digital multimeter, backprobe the ECM connector (do not disconnect) and measure the 5-volt reference circuit with key on, engine off. You should read between 4.85-5.15 volts. If voltage is absent or significantly low, disconnect sensors one at a time while monitoring voltage to isolate a shorted component.
Step 3: Inspect Individual Sensor Connectors Remove and inspect connectors at the throttle position sensor, MAP sensor, and fuel rail pressure sensor. Look for green corrosion, bent pins, or moisture intrusion. Clean with electrical contact cleaner and apply dielectric grease before reconnection.
Step 4: Check for Shorts to Ground With ECM disconnected and key off, use your multimeter's resistance function to check continuity between the 5-volt reference wire and ground. Any reading below 10,000 ohms indicates a short circuit requiring harness repair or sensor replacement.
Step 5: Verify Repair with Diagnostic Software After repairs, use Hitachi Dr.EX diagnostic software or a compatible J1939 scanner to clear codes and monitor live sensor data. Verify all sensors powered by the reference circuit show proper voltage and the code does not return after a 30-minute operational test under load.
Critical Used Equipment Note: Before replacing the ECM (a $2,000+ component), always verify harness integrity and connector condition—80% of P0641 codes on used machines stem from wiring issues, not ECM failure.
